Sir Alex Ferguson believes Anderson's recent form has 'cranked up the contest' for a place in Manchester United's midfield.

Anderson has made 91 appearances for United since his 2007 move from Porto, but has struggled for consistency during his time at Old Trafford.

He has shown flashes of his ability, but has yet to command a regular place in the Red Devils team, having started only eight of the club's 17 Premier League games this season.

However, Ferguson has been impressed by the 21-year-old's recent form and is confident Anderson is thriving on the competition for a spot in central midfield.

"Midfield is the hardest area for our young players to progress because we have some excellent players operating in that department," the United boss told the club's official website.

"But Anderson has certainly cranked up the contest for places after hitting great form. He took his time - he's only 21, remember! - but he has settled and matured.

"The competition has not dimmed his self-belief, which is important. He has a Brazilian belief in his own ability and he is going to become a top player.

"He is flying at the moment and he certainly wants to play. In fact, he has a face on him like a bag of tripe when I don't play him."
